Output 422a01368c7703e9c6103197b81e4abc8015e99981c3ebbd272cc6a167940a3a:1

value
509986974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4890479a608814cec5beeaf7f3c252008f267455 OP_EQUAL
address
38JhR5sXHafUawtAZR4rEJumNSApQEqW3Y
transaction
422a01368c7703e9c6103197b81e4abc8015e99981c3ebbd272cc6a167940a3a
confirmations
277294
spent
true